Description
Job Summary:
Nuclear Medicine Technologist in Springfield, Missouri. This position involves performing diagnostic nuclear medicine imaging procedures accurately and independently. The role requires collaboration with the healthcare team to ensure high-quality patient care, adherence to safety protocols, and proper operation of imaging equipment.
Job Details:
- Shift Schedule: Days, 8 hours per shift, minimum of 40 hours per week
- Required Qualifications: Certification from Nuclear Medicine Technology Certification Board (NMTCB) or The American Registry of Radiologic Technologists - Nuclear (RT-N), BLS (American Heart Association), 1 year of experience as a Nuclear Medicine Technologist, within Springfield, Missouri area
- Preferred Qualifications: PET experience
- Float: Float rotation may be required
- Additional Information: Candidates should have a satisfactory completion of formal radiologic technology training in an American Medical Association (AMA) approved school and be registered with the American Registry of Radiologic Technologists (ARRT) in CT. The candidate must be capable of manipulating equipment, evaluating images, lifting and moving patients, and maintaining good communication skills while working in a fast-paced environment.

About Springfield, MO
As a Travel Nuclear Medicine Technologist in Springfield, MO here's what you should know:- The cost of living in Springfield, MO is lower than the national average, making it an affordable place to live.
- Wages generally match up with the lower cost of living.
- The average high in summer is around 87°F, and the average low in winter is around 22°F.
- Short term rentals are relatively easy to find in Springfield, MO, with options ranging from apartments to furnished homes.
- Springfield is car-friendly, with a well-maintained road network.
- Public transportation options are available but may be limited compared to larger cities.
- Springfield has a diverse population with a wide age range.
- Common health issues may include allergies and respiratory conditions.
- There is a growing population of travel nurses due to the presence of several healthcare facilities.
- There are plenty of restaurants offering diverse cuisines, and the city has a vibrant art and music scene.
- Sports enthusiasts can enjoy various local and college-level sports events.
- Outdoor activities such as hiking, fishing, and camping are popular due to the city's proximity to nature.
